European Data Centres Leading the Way Against Climate Change

LogoThe European Tech industry is leading the way in the transition to a climate neutral economy. Leading cloud and infrastructure providers and data centre operators have created the Climate Neutral Data Centre Pact in which a plethora of companies and associations, including the most significant industry players, have agreed to a self-regulatory initiative to make European data centres carbon neutral by 2030. Frans Timmermans, European Commission Executive Vice-President for the European Green Deal stated, "Citizens across Europe use even more technology to go about their daily lives and want this technology, also to help secure a sustainable future for people and planet."

Glocomms – Working Towards a Fairer European Cloud

LogoThe end of last year saw steps being made towards a fair and competitive European Cloud network with the proposal of the Digital Markets Act. The act put forward by the European Commission serves to ensure fair and open digital markets as part of a new European digital strategy. According to the European EC, this means that innovators and technology start-ups will be able to reap new opportunities to compete and innovate in the online platform environment without having to comply with unfair terms and conditions limiting their development. "We must realise that this is not just about ensuring a fair and competitive market. Actions that limit the choice of business customers in Europe, who are increasingly moving their digital tools and services to the cloud, have a real and direct impact on growth and innovation," said Stefano Cecconi, CEO of Aruba and Vice President of CISPE. He went on to say, "The behaviour of entrenched providers may have [a] massive impact on European customers' right to choose the cloud solution that best fits their needs."
